Output 385337e035d5e3cf876a665ad3fc77d4bc03e5405adb96377941a9ade68d6b0c:1

value
1401590611
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 528a835115e87ceb919cd77aeba08eb684e62b09 OP_EQUALVERIFY OP_CHECKSIG
address
18XSLnBZ8ydMUkaifU6sQBMJzmm7JvDeUp
transaction
385337e035d5e3cf876a665ad3fc77d4bc03e5405adb96377941a9ade68d6b0c
spent
true